The Barn Studio in New Britain, PA is actually a converted barn that has retained a lot of the feel of the original building, including the rough-hewn walls and wide-planked barn floors. With its masculine vibe, it is an excellent venue for exploring male boudoir photo ideas. We can imagine a man styled in a Stetson hat and boots, hunting gear, or even motorcycle gear would work well in this space. This Light and Dark Loft in Dallas, Texas is a two-room suite. The light-colored living area with off-white couches and a light rug has a wall of windows and is filled with light. Plus, the adjoining dark bedroom has black walls, dark sheets, and a dark green Chesterfield couch, which makes for a very masculine vibe. This photoshoot could be styled both ways, with an “angel” and a “devil” vibe, for two sexy photoshoots in one.
